Output 8591f21c38021a1955457f6e1cda5fadf964bae8f5a2c2acf44998da16805262:1

value
658258
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1014bd8d115b047547596f91e7a559163ad86aa6 OP_EQUALVERIFY OP_CHECKSIG
address
12U2f97b24B9zr17LgCoQVGv4iabcBHwAS
transaction
8591f21c38021a1955457f6e1cda5fadf964bae8f5a2c2acf44998da16805262
spent
true